Clean DB 2.1d install won't work under linux :rolleyes:

For those linux users having trouble getting DB to work under linux see <A HREF="http://forums.gameservers.net/showthrea ... 6112">this thread</A> (scroll down to my post which subject is "It's working!!!").

Any change DB 2.1e would have a little fix so that it would work under linux without some stupid ini tweak? You only need to change two lines and delete one in default.ini anyway... Atleast make sure (if you can) that the version of DB that's going to be in UT2004 Collectors Edition will work under linux without needing to change anything.

It wouldn't be a bad idea if you'd create some kind of naming policy for the files, like that if a filename has DB standing for Deathball it would be written DB, not db or Db and if there is Deathball it would be Deathball, not deathball. That's because linux is case sensitive, meaning that you can have files like Deathball.u, deathball.u, DEATHBALL.U etc in same directory (while in Windows those would be same file). So if you release a update which has a new version of some file, say Deathball.u and it happens to be named deathball.u instead of Deathball.u, linux users will end up having Deathball.u and deathball.u in their ut2004/deathball/System directory and ut2004 will use Deathball.u instead of the new deathball.u. And Deathball.u has been named deathball.u since DB 2.1b, so Team Vortex, change it back to Deathball.u and linux users, make sure that you have only one deathball.u in ut2004/deathball/system directory and if there is two, delete the older one.
